178086/Turbocharger
169646 BORGWARNER
BORGWARNER 169646 can be replaced by BORG WARNER
178086
Turbocharger
178086
Turbocharger
MSRP : $1084.10
$1084.10
Out of stock
Total price : $1084.10
View Details
;